The Dishwasher role at Red Robin is an essential part of the kitchen team, responsible for maintaining cleanliness and sanitation standards to ensure a smooth kitchen operation. The dishwasher’s primary duty is to wash, clean, and sort dishes and kitchen tools efficiently while adhering to food safety and cleanliness regulations. This position is ideal for individuals looking to start their career in the restaurant industry as it offers hands-on experience in a fast-paced environment and an opportunity to learn about food preparation. In addition to washing dishes, the dishwasher may assist with basic food prep tasks to help the kitchen run efficiently. The role is paid hourly, with a range of $11.61 to $14.00 per hour, and includes benefits such as a free meal during each shift, flexible scheduling, employee discounts, referral bonuses, and additional compensation opportunities. Applicants must be at least 17 years old to qualify for this role. Red Robin also provides comprehensive health benefits eligibility, retirement plans, paid time off, and many growth opportunities within its team, making this a promising position for those passionate about hospitality, cleanliness, and teamwork.

Job Requirements

  • Must be 17 or older
  • Ability to stand for long periods
  • Willingness to work flexible schedules
  • Ability to follow safety and sanitation guidelines
  • Reliable and punctual
  • Physically able to lift and carry heavy items

Job Qualifications

  • High school diploma or equivalent preferred
  • Previous experience in a restaurant or kitchen environment is a plus
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ced environment
  • Strong attention to detail
  • Good communication skills
  • Ability to work as part of a team

Job Duties

  • Maintain cleanliness of kitchen and work areas
  • Properly wash and sort dishes and utensils
  • Adhere to food handling and safety guidelines
  • Assist with food preparation tasks as needed
  • Support kitchen staff to ensure efficient operations
